Senator Elizabeth Warren Suspension of Her Presidential Campaign

Following her decision to suspend her 2020 Democratic presidential candidacy, Senator Elizabeth Warren (D-MA) spoke to reporters in Cambridge, Massachusetts. After brief remarks, she took questions from members of the media. Many were about sexism toward the presidential candidates. The senator made brief remarks about that, but she would be speaking about the issue in-depth at a later date. Senator Warren was also asked if she plans to endorse any of the 2020 Democratic presidential candidates. On that, she said she is going to sit back and reflect before making a decision about an endorsement. close
